Output 3dbaae8ae329cfc77e71865ef3eb440443037aec9d59877d5b44a2ec7e4cbb88:0

value
61739700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ca18180242cc9fd4439e53786db349469bf9ff66 OP_EQUAL
address
3L7bHMmugJ2B2VzJmcW9eZsSkrdweVqFkE
transaction
3dbaae8ae329cfc77e71865ef3eb440443037aec9d59877d5b44a2ec7e4cbb88
spent
true